
Vitaly
05.09.2018
11:24:19
history mode только убрал решетку # из URL-ов
зато добавил другой фигни

Sergey
05.09.2018
11:27:10
Коллеги, у нас в компании принимается решение в выборе фронтенд фреемворка, нужно сравнить vue, react, angular
Есть ли хорошая таблица сравнения обьективная и подробная?

Александр
05.09.2018
11:27:27
подскажите какой самый норм валидатор для форм, с кастомной проверкой

Google

Александр
05.09.2018
11:27:37
VeeValidate
пользовался кто?

Иван
05.09.2018
11:28:05
Кстати, а как тут ща борются с китайскимиботамисрекламойвоченьдлинномнике?

Daniil
05.09.2018
11:28:40
Я когда тестил Реакт или Вью, брал приложуху и пилил его на том, потом на том

Vlad
05.09.2018
11:29:57
Забрасывайте помидорами

Daniil
05.09.2018
11:30:07
реакт функциональщина?

Sergey
05.09.2018
11:30:07

Иван
05.09.2018
11:30:08

Daniil
05.09.2018
11:30:08
шо?
Ты если дальше пропсов не ходил, то для тебя скорее всего

Иван
05.09.2018
11:30:50
Самая подробная таблица, какую смог найти

Google

Sergey
05.09.2018
11:30:53

Vlad
05.09.2018
11:31:27

Sergei
05.09.2018
11:31:48
Приветули народ. Кто делал генерацию sitemap.xml подскажите какими инструментами пользовались? Как обходили динамические маршруты(у меня есть 345 валидных вариантов для одного динамического роута, надо их в карту сайта засунуть)? Сам нашел плагинчик vue-router-sitemap но 6 звезд на гитхабе — это риск))

Sergey
05.09.2018
11:31:49

Daniil
05.09.2018
11:31:54
Ну, тогда ты знаешь что редакс поддреживате как раз чистое
к чему тогда это было выше сказано?

Иван
05.09.2018
11:32:13
https://about.gitlab.com/2017/11/09/gitlab-vue-one-year-later/

Vlad
05.09.2018
11:32:53

Daniil
05.09.2018
11:33:01
ну да, шо то шо то
не понимаю тут спор
берешь технологии
тестишь на проекте
и решаете

Sergey
05.09.2018
11:33:16
Почему разной?
Писать на ангуляре какую-то элементарную СПА - все равно, что гвохдь забивать сваебоем)

Sergey
05.09.2018
11:33:48
Как убедить компанию выбрать именно vue?

Иван
05.09.2018
11:34:22

Daniil
05.09.2018
11:34:32
Компания должна выбрать то, на чем разработчикам приятней будет писать и удобней

Иван
05.09.2018
11:34:37
Они с ним уже два года живут

Sergey
05.09.2018
11:34:48
и лара выбрали вуй)

Google

Daniil
05.09.2018
11:34:59
значит надо тестить всем на определенном спа

Sergey
05.09.2018
11:35:11

Daniil
05.09.2018
11:35:11
может у вас там любители тайпскрипта сидят
или rxjs

Sergey
05.09.2018
11:35:33
у нас выбрали реакт и я не скажу, что все довольны

Vlad
05.09.2018
11:35:34

Sergey
05.09.2018
11:36:05
)
Vue нормально тайпскрипт поддерживает?

Daniil
05.09.2018
11:36:49
насчет этого хз, вроде неоч

Vlad
05.09.2018
11:36:52
Плохо. Но он там не нужен

Daniil
05.09.2018
11:37:06
вбросьте им простое приложение и пусть реализуют на всех трех стульях

Vlad
05.09.2018
11:37:10
Отделяйте бизнес логику и пишите ее на чем угодно (с чем угодно)

Daniil
05.09.2018
11:37:12
и решайте
работать на том, что не нравится не есть хорошо)0

Vlad
05.09.2018
11:38:01

Daniil
05.09.2018
11:38:30
Это да, спасибо кто переводит

Sergey
05.09.2018
11:39:38
Просто компания большая, людей много, они не понимают что им нравится пока не попробуют. Я писал немного на react и angular 1, сейчас на vue - мне он оч нравится. У меня задача убедить остальных

Sergei
05.09.2018
11:39:50
с фига ли плохо поддерживает typescript? некоторые сервисы мейл.ру и весь новый озон на vue + typescript и полет нормальный. я тоже на своих проектах ts юзаю с вью и доволен

Sergey
05.09.2018
11:39:53
Хочу подготовить агрументы почему

Google

Sergey
05.09.2018
11:40:09

Alex
05.09.2018
11:40:54
озон еще только переписывают худо бедно

Sergey
05.09.2018
11:41:03
1. Дока на русском
2. ..
Нужно просто по пунктам расписать

Alex
05.09.2018
11:41:07
в мейлах свои проблемы
и поверь что там с накстом в озоне делают - никто не проектах меньше не будет повторять

Sergei
05.09.2018
11:41:55
проблемы есть везде, но проект делаются) да, нету автокомплита в шаблонах как в ангуляре, но это доп фича крутая и ее отсутствие не показатель хуевости

Иван
05.09.2018
11:42:13
Так-то есть автокомплит в шаблон у вебшторма

Alex
05.09.2018
11:42:21
у них там RPC архитектура если что

Sergey
05.09.2018
11:42:28

Admin
ERROR: S client not available

Alex
05.09.2018
11:42:29
там типизация действительно нужна

Иван
05.09.2018
11:42:53
Не везде, правда (например, mapState/getters/actions vuexовские не комплитит), но есть, и подсветка оч хорошая

Sergey
05.09.2018
11:44:13
Как вы выбирали какой фрамворк использовать у себя на проэкте, есть же какие-то критерии при выборе?

Иван
05.09.2018
11:44:13
В том числе и кастомные компоненты
Шо на хайпе то и берут)
Вью вот хайпанул малость и его выбирать стали


Daniil
05.09.2018
11:44:35
Реакт
— нормальная документация,
— используется во многих компаниях: от Фейсбука до Нетфликса и российских лэндигов по продаже ножей-кредиток,
— 4 года продакшена,
— большое коммьюнити: много готовых модулей,
— специалистов много,
— делает Фейсбук и открыты к опенсорсу.
Вью
— отличная документация и очень лёгкий старт,
— используется у китайцев, они же и вливают деньги в развитие,
— пару лет в продакшене,
— развивающееся коммьюнити, но мало готовых модулей,
— желающих специалистов много,
— делает один человек, но Алибаба вливает деньги в поддержку.
Ангулар
— не очень понятная документация,
— после жёсткого перехода AngularJS → Angular 2 очень многие компании отвалились,
— полтора года в продакшене,
— не такое больше коммьюнити из-за второго пункта,
— нравится в основном бэкэндерам, а у них не самый лучший фронтэнд получается,
— поддержка вендора хорошая: типизирован плюс из коробки есть роутинг, формы и всё остальное.
Это все конечно холивар, но все же надо топить за то, чтобы компания села и попробовала на всех трех написать что - то. Показывать достоинства одного из трех, при этом не упоминав другие, хз - хз


Stanislav
05.09.2018
11:44:36

Google


Sergey
05.09.2018
11:45:39
Реакт
— нормальная документация,
— используется во многих компаниях: от Фейсбука до Нетфликса и российских лэндигов по продаже ножей-кредиток,
— 4 года продакшена,
— большое коммьюнити: много готовых модулей,
— специалистов много,
— делает Фейсбук и открыты к опенсорсу.
Вью
— отличная документация и очень лёгкий старт,
— используется у китайцев, они же и вливают деньги в развитие,
— пару лет в продакшене,
— развивающееся коммьюнити, но мало готовых модулей,
— желающих специалистов много,
— делает один человек, но Алибаба вливает деньги в поддержку.
Ангулар
— не очень понятная документация,
— после жёсткого перехода AngularJS → Angular 2 очень многие компании отвалились,
— полтора года в продакшене,
— не такое больше коммьюнити из-за второго пункта,
— нравится в основном бэкэндерам, а у них не самый лучший фронтэнд получается,
— поддержка вендора хорошая: типизирован плюс из коробки есть роутинг, формы и всё остальное.
Это все конечно холивар, но все же надо топить за то, чтобы компания села и попробовала на всех трех написать что - то. Показывать достоинства одного из трех, при этом не упоминав другие, хз - хз
спасибо
@Tchernyavsky откудово инфа?


Иван
05.09.2018
11:46:00
Я могу только сказать что между реактом и вью я безусловно выберу вью. На реакте достаточно сложное приложение поддерживаю и развиваю и на вью оно было бы попроще и поудобней

Daniil
05.09.2018
11:46:20
в плане ангуляра немного не согласен, тур героев хороший

Vlad
05.09.2018
11:46:43
Спроси в реакт чате про вью ?

Daniil
05.09.2018
11:46:46
rxjs це есть хорошо в больших приложениях

Sergey
05.09.2018
11:47:02

Andrew
05.09.2018
11:47:03
Стримы всегда он
Даже если не нужны

Daniil
05.09.2018
11:47:32
если у вас большое приложение, придется юзать подобие flux - а.
тут уже надо и в эту степь смотреть и выбирать удобное

Sergey
05.09.2018
11:48:21
нам еще важна возможность постепенного перехода, что бы часть работала на старом а чатсь на новом)

Daniil
05.09.2018
11:48:40
ну шо реакт шо вью, там нативный жс конечно есть
ангуляр уже тайпскрипт в основном
да и тут уже смотреть надо что верстальщикам зайдет. Мне в реакте нравится styled components, насчет вью он вроде не такой.

Stanislav
05.09.2018
11:50:42

Sergey
05.09.2018
11:50:47
styled components - это что такое?

Daniil
05.09.2018
11:51:06
CSS in JS что - то вроде

Alex
05.09.2018
11:51:16
дичь короче для тех кто верстать не умеет
;3

Andrew
05.09.2018
11:51:20

Daniil
05.09.2018
11:51:21
эм